Release Notes
2026-03-08
Condition-axis contract parity update:
Added
generator_versionandgenerator_capabilitiestoPOST /api/entityresponses.Added canonical numeric
axesoutput (axis -> {label, score}) while preserving existingcharacterandoccupationlabel payloads.Added
numeric_axis_scoresgenerator capability token for adapter feature detection.Added
axis_profilerequest/response metadata for/api/entityand/api/entities/batch.Defaulted
axis_profiletocharacter_fullso API output now includes the full canonical character+occupation axis set.Preserved historical sparse optional-axis output under explicit
axis_profile="subset_legacy".Aligned canonical label ordering for
physiqueandhealthwith mud-server policy.Aligned occupation
visibilitylabel spelling to canonicaldiscrete.Updated tests to lock metadata, dual-format axis payloads, and label-order contracts.